Solution for 14*14=7(r+7) equation:


Simplifying
14 * 14 = 7(r + 7)

Multiply 14 * 14
196 = 7(r + 7)

Reorder the terms:
196 = 7(7 + r)
196 = (7 * 7 + r * 7)
196 = (49 + 7r)

Solving
196 = 49 + 7r

Solving for variable 'r'.

Move all terms containing r to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-7r' to each side of the equation.
196 + -7r = 49 + 7r + -7r

Combine like terms: 7r + -7r = 0
196 + -7r = 49 + 0
196 + -7r = 49

Add '-196' to each side of the equation.
196 + -196 + -7r = 49 + -196

Combine like terms: 196 + -196 = 0
0 + -7r = 49 + -196
-7r = 49 + -196

Combine like terms: 49 + -196 = -147
-7r = -147

Divide each side by '-7'.
r = 21

Simplifying
r = 21
